Historical Mumbai: Places to Visit & Stories to Uncover
Delve through the extensive tapestry of ancient Mumbai, a urban area brimming with intriguing narratives and notable landmarks. Discover the renowned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us, once Victoria Terminus, a magnificent example of Victorian Gothic architecture, and roam through the animated lanes of Crawford Market, a established trading hub. Uncover the history of Elephanta Island's rock-cut temples, a UNESCO World Heritage site, or follow the British influence at the Gateway of India. Don't miss Dr. Bhau Daji Lad Mumbai City Museum to receive a deeper perspective into the city's evolution and its special heritage. Each brick whispers a story of a dynamic past.
